Skip to content

Welcome to Setgreet Docs

Learn how to build native in-app experiences with Setgreet.

Welcome to Setgreet Docs

Setgreet is the control layer for mobile in-app experiences. It gives product teams a visual dashboard to build, target, and publish native screens inside their iOS and Android apps -- without shipping app updates.

Use Setgreet to create onboarding walkthroughs, feature announcements, in-app surveys, NPS prompts, upgrade nudges, and any other flow your users should see at the right moment.

How it works

  1. Design screens in the visual flow builder with text, buttons, inputs, media, and more.
  2. Define targeting rules so flows reach the right users at the right time.
  3. Publish instantly -- the mobile SDK renders flows natively, no app release required.
  4. Measure results with built-in analytics on views, completions, and component interactions.

Key sections

SectionWhat you will find
Getting StartedCreate an account, register your app, install the SDK, and publish your first flow.
FlowsDeep dive into the flow builder, screens, triggers, branching, and the publish lifecycle.
ComponentsReference for every component you can place on a screen -- text, buttons, inputs, feedback widgets, and more.
PersonalizationVariable bindings, user attributes, and dynamic content.
Audience & TargetingTrigger conditions, user segments, and event-based targeting.
ExperimentsA/B testing and experimentation for flows.
AnalyticsFlow-level and component-level analytics, funnel tracking, and exports.
IntegrationsConnect Setgreet to your analytics stack and third-party tools.
SDK ReferencePlatform-specific SDK guides for iOS, Android, React Native, and Flutter.
Team & BillingOrganization management, roles, and subscription plans.

New to Setgreet? Start with the Getting Started guide to go from zero to a published flow in under 30 minutes.

On this page